Rice Mill Wastewater: A Special Case
Rice milling, especially when comparing raw rice to parboiled rice processing, produces widely varying wastewater in terms of:
BOD (Biochemical Oxygen Demand)
COD (Chemical Oxygen Demand)
TSS (Total Suspended Solids)
Oil & Grease
Color, Odor, and pH variability
These differences necessitate a specialized approach to treatment.

Typical Wastewater Characteristics
From Restaurants, Hotels, and Food Courts:
Food waste, starches, and organic solids
High levels of fats, oils, and grease (FOG)
Detergents, soaps, and sanitizers
Suspended solids, foul odors, and emulsified organics
Elevated BOD (Biochemical Oxygen Demand) and COD (Chemical Oxygen Demand)
From Dairy Processing Units:
Milk spillage, whey, and lactose
Wastewater from CIP (Cleaning-in-Place) systems
Fats, proteins, and chemical residues
Fluctuating pH and high organic load
VEPL’s Proven 4-Stage ETP Process
Our modular, urban-friendly, and low-footprint systems are designed for efficient, compliant, and long-term performance.
1️ Pre-Treatment
Oil & Grease Trap to capture fats and cooking oils
Bar/Sieve Screening for food particles and solids
Equalization Tank with aeration to stabilize flow and load
2️ Physio-Chemical Treatment
pH Correction and dosing for optimal chemical conditions
Coagulation & Flocculation to separate emulsified fats and solids
Primary Settler or Tube Settler for effective sludge removal
3️ Biological Treatment
MBBR (Moving Bed Biofilm Reactor) or ASP (Activated Sludge Process)
Efficient aerobic degradation of organic pollutants
Fine bubble diffusers and energy-efficient blowers
4️ tertiary & Polishing Treatment
Multigrade Sand Filter (MGF) and Activated Carbon Filter (ACF)
UV Disinfection or Chlorination for pathogen elimination
Ultra Filtration (UF) for water reuse in toilet flushing, gardening, and floor washing

Knowledgeable Insight by VEPL
In today’s scenario, plastic is everywhere, and the trend of plastic reuse and recycling is booming. Entrepreneurs and industries across India are capitalizing on the growing demand for recycled plastic. A major part of this process is the pressure washing of PET bottles and other plastic waste, which consumes a large volume of water.
Without a proper treatment system, this results in significant water wastage and environmental challenges. VEPL addresses this issue with our advanced Hydro Plast ETP, which enables up to 90% water recovery, allowing treated water to be reused in the washing process, greatly reducing the dependency on fresh water and lowering operational costs.

Treatment Process Overview:
Equalization Tank – Stabilizes the flow and pollutant concentration
pH Correction & Chemical Dosing – Adjusts acidity/alkalinity for optimal treatment
Ferric Sulphate Dosing – Essential for coagulation and effective removal of suspended solids and ink pigments
Hypo Dosing (Sodium Hypochlorite) – Crucial for decolorization, breaks down color-causing compounds
Coagulation & Flocculation – Enhances the settling of fine particles and residual dyes
Primary & Secondary Clarification – Allows settled sludge to separate from treated water
Sand & Activated Carbon Filtration – Final stage to remove any residual color, odor, and organic load
Water Recycling System – Enables up to 90% reuse of treated water back into the process

2 . INDUSTRYWISE EFFLUENT TREATMENT PLANT
Industry-wise Effluent Treatment Plant Solutions
Customized ETPs for Every Industrial Sector
At Ventilair Engineers Pvt. Ltd. (VEPL), we understand that effluent characteristics vary significantly across industries. That’s why we offer tailor-made ETP solutions designed to meet the specific chemical, organic, and physical loads of each sector.
Below is a quick overview of how VEPL adapts its ETP design to suit different industries:
Industry
ETP Design Focus
Textile & Dyeing
Handles high COD, color, and salt load; includes equalization, biological, ACF, RO
Pharmaceutical
High BOD/COD, toxic compounds; advanced treatment with MBBR/MBR, tertiary polishing
Chemical & Fertilizers
Complex pH, heavy metals; pH correction, neutralization, clarifiers, filters
Food & Dairy
High organic load; MBBR/SBR + sludge dewatering and odor control
Automotive & Electroplating
Heavy metals and oil; includes oil separator, chemical treatment, and polishing

Working Principle:
Our Physico-Chemical ETPs use a combination of chemical coagulation, flocculation, pH adjustment, sedimentation, and filtration to remove impurities from wastewater. The process helps in:
Neutralizing pH
Precipitating heavy metals
Breaking emulsions
Separating sludge for further treatment or disposal
